As an advocate of forehand rollers, that shot is not possible on this hole. And much harder than just taking your 3 and leaving on this hole. Lots of 4's, 5's are made on this hole from 1000 rated players. Only about 30% of 1000-rated players 3 this hole from the Gold tee during our tournaments.
